I'm passionate about improving medical care, and its impact on public health. Joining the 10KFS team is an exciting opportunity to be involved in a study that strives to represent the rich population diversity in Minnesota, which can help in the understanding and prevention of health conditions for future generations. 

I was born on a small island in the South of Mexico, obtained my Medical Doctor degree in Mexico and worked as a General Physician. Before moving to Minnesota in 2022, I worked in medical research for four years in Texas. Thanks to working with a diverse group of patients in Mexico, Texas and now Minnesota, it helped me better understand the different viewpoints of patients with different backgrounds and needs, which made my goal to be a Primary Care Physician in the USA stronger because I love that in Primary Care you never see only one type of person, you see their whole family.

My role at 10KFS as a Research Study Coordinator is to recruit families, and clarify any possible concerns and questions they might have about the study. Making sure that a family understands their great and vital contribution by being part of this cohort study can change their perspective on the role of Research in Public health, and what Research is really about.
